Expert Review
Starting a career in construction can be daunting, but ECS Limited offers a unique entry-level position as a Construction Materials Testing Field Technician. Paid training ensures that newcomers can learn the ropes without prior experience, while the company even covers certification fees, making it financially accessible. The role involves field activities such as observing and testing materials like soils and concrete, which is crucial for construction project success.
While the position offers substantial growth potential, it is essential to be aware that the work can be physically demanding. Employees will often find themselves outdoors, which may include working in adverse weather conditions. The supportive environment provided by seasoned professionals helps in navigating these challenges, but the entry-level salary may not be as high as other skilled positions in the industry.
Overall, this opportunity is not for everyone. Those who prefer a desk job or have limited physical capacity may struggle. However, for motivated individuals eager to learn and grow in the construction sector, this entry-level role serves as a solid foundation.
